Tower
The is a stone tower in the municipality of in the canton of in . It is part of the Teller / Palisaden medieval fortifications which are a Swiss heritage site of national significance. is situated 130 metres east of Stansstad (See).

Railway station
is a railway station in the in the canton of Nidwalden. It is on the Luzern–Stans–Engelberg line, owned by the Zentralbahn railway company, and is adjacent to the bridge that carries the line across the Alpnachersee arm of and into the Lopper II tunnel. is situated 490 metres south of Stansstad (See).
